Thomson spent four seasons with the Tribe from 1997-01,
before moving into a head coaching position at the University of Minnesota. He
led the Golden Gopher program for 11 seasons before returning to W&M as its
ninth head women's tennis coach on June 21. During his time in Minneapolis,
Thomson led Minnesota to 111 victories and the program's first Big Ten
Championship in 2003.
